WE-CMB Common Mode Power Line Inductors (Chokes)

Würth Elektronik WE-CMB Common Mode Power Line Inductors (Chokes) feature a compact design that delivers high suppression of asymmetric interferences, even at low-frequency ranges. In addition, these inductors provide broadband screening due to a low capacitance winding technique. Würth Elektronik WE-CMB Common Mode, Power Line Inductors, are ideal for power electronics and suppressing common-mode noises. Parasitics can have a significant effect on the noise attenuation and current rating of a common mode filter. Würth designed the WE-CMB series for minimal parasitic effects over its useful frequency bandwidth so it does what it is designed to do - get rid of the noise.
